The Boy Who Could Not Read
One day on a cold windy morning, there was a boy named Mike. Mike was 14 in the sixth grade. He loved to play basketball with his friends after school in the park. His best friends’ names are John and Greg. They would meet each other by the park every other day at 4:00 but they had to be home before dark. Then they would call each other on the phone to help each other with their schoolwork. Then they would get up bright and early to get ready for school and then they would meet up at the corner of 131st. They waited for the bus to come so they can go to school. They arrived at New Price Middle School. Mike walked into the door for reading. The teacher said, “Sit and stop playing.” They had 45 minutes in each class. After 45 minutes, class was over. It was time for recess and everyone left except Mike. The teacher asked, “What do you want Mike?” “I need help,” Mike said. “With what?” She said. “Reading,” Mike said. She said, “It might take five months.” After five months, Mike was reading on the sixth grade level. Then Mike thanked his teacher for all of her help.
The End
Written by Dee and Suree
